Excel数组任列查找另一列不重复值自定义函数

在过去的文章中,我们介绍了如何使用Excel的TEXTSY函数来处理文本分离和合并的功能。然而,对于在数组中查找其他列的数据以及处理重复查找数据的问题,VLOOKUP函数无法满足需求。因此,我们今天将分享另一个自定义函数——VLOOKUPAR来解决这些问题。

Excel数组任列查找另一列不重复值自定义函数

功能

VLOOKUPAR函数的功能是在数组的任一列(即使有重复值)中查找另一列,并通过在行之间移动返回单元格的值。与VLOOKUP函数不同的是,VLOOKUPAR函数可以处理重复值,并返回不重复的结果。如果找不到匹配的值,它将返回错误值N/A。

语法

VLOOKUPAR(lookup_value,col_index_num1,table_array,col_index_num2,range_lookup)

- lookup_value:需要在表格数组的任一列中查找的数值。可以是数值或引用。

- col_index_num1:table_array中lookup_value列的序号。

- table_array:包含两列或多列数据的区域。可以使用区域引用或区域名称。

- col_index_num2:待返回的匹配值所在列的序号。例如,当col_index_num2为1时,返回table_array中第一列的值;当col_index_num2为2时,返回table_array中第二列的值,以此类推。如果col_index_num2小于1,则VLOOKUPAR函数将返回错误值VALUE!;如果col_index_num2大于table_array的列数,VLOOKUPAR函数将返回错误值REF!。

- range_lookup:Lookup_value上方的Lookup_value值区域的单元格。

应用示例

假设我们有一个包含员工姓名和对应部门的表格。现在,我们想要在这个表格中根据员工姓名查找他们所在的部门。

首先,我们需要在表格中选择一个空白单元格,假设我们选择了A5。接下来,我们输入以下公式:

VLOOKUPAR(A2, 1:2, 2, FALSE)

其中,A2是我们要查找的员工姓名,1:2代表整个表格的范围,2表示我们要返回的部门所在列,FALSE表示精确匹配。

按下回车后,就会在A5单元格中显示该员工所在的部门。如果找不到匹配的姓名,它将返回错误值N/A。

总结

通过使用VLOOKUPAR函数,我们可以在Excel中实现在数组的任意列中查找另一列的值,并且可以处理重复值和返回不重复的结果。这个自定义函数的应用场景非常广泛,可以帮助我们更高效地处理各种数据查找和分析的需求。修法布施得聪明智慧,多分享让生活更美好。

标签:

最新文章

  1. 宠物猫的品种(猫一共有几个品种?)2025-03-18
  2. 怎么解析子域名 请问·域名要怎么填写?2025-03-21
  3. 怎么修改wifi设置使wifi变快 网络变快的方法?2025-03-11
  4. 用html做一个美食网站 去哪可以找到用于制作视频的片头、片尾的模板视频和音频素材?2025-03-17
  5. 风机钓竿能不能打在梁上(7公斤的吊扇要怎么样安装吊杆?)2025-03-22
  6. 关机界面使用锁定模式有啥用 华为手机如何快速启动锁定模式?2025-03-18
  7. cml资本市场线 cml代表什么单位?2025-03-26
  8. 搜狗输入法PC端斗图功能全方位指南2025-03-11
  9. html网页设计代码 设计师们经常逛的网站有哪些?2025-03-27
  10. autocad上方菜单栏没有怎么办 cad2021如何显示菜单栏?2025-03-12
  11. 给我一个企业邮箱账号 古耐属于什么档次?2025-03-30
  12. java中属于容器的组件 新手如何学习Java?2025-03-26
  13. 路由器怎么设置密码视频 在手机上怎么设置路由器密码?2025-03-31
  14. 618活动各个平台什么时候开始 京东一分钱买东西什么时候?2025-03-17
  15. 1怎么输入 word文档怎么输入一个字符?2025-03-15
  16. 适合服装的商标名 要为品牌名称做设计,需要遵循哪些原则?2025-03-18
  17. cad圆角测量方法 CAD圆角标注的的方法?2025-03-14
  18. 怎么成为美篇精选2025-03-09
  19. 请问下苹果在哪儿维修 苹果官方售后网点查询?2025-03-23
  20. 优秀网站网页设计 电商设计工资待遇怎么样?2025-03-28
  21. 华为手机的主题怎么关掉 华为用了主题之后怎么解除?2025-03-11
  22. word表格照片栏插入图片不全显示 Word表格图片显示问题解决方法2025-03-15
  23. 在浏览器上怎么扫二维码 鞋子上的二维码怎么扫?2025-03-15
  24. 诺诗兰防晒衣有防晒效果吗(伯希和诺诗兰哪个好?)2025-03-24
  25. 如何在WPS文档中设置单栏页面2025-03-13
  26. qq浏览器怎么添加通讯录好友2025-03-16
  27. 苹果电脑恢复格式化硬盘 苹果笔记本硬盘格式化了怎么恢复系统?2025-03-10
  28. 电子屏的像素怎么回事 描述显示器所能显示的像素数量的概念是?2025-03-19
  29. 如何设置 Word 文档属性摘要信息2025-03-07
  30. 西安营销策划公司排名 互联网营销专业哪些学校有?哪个学校的口碑好呢?2025-03-25
优质自媒体
优质自媒体 微信号:优质自媒体 扫描二维码关注公众号
优质自媒体

小编推荐

  1. 1 WORD文档无法打开的三种解决办法

    作为工作中最常用的办公软件,WORD文件的使用频繁程度也不言而喻。但是,有时候我们会遇到这样的情况:突然间无法打开WORD文档,甚至还提示一些错误信息,让人十分苦恼。本文将介绍几种解决方法,帮助您重新打开WORD文档。 确认文件是否有问题首

  2. 2 Excel复制多个不连续的区域的方法

    在使用Excel进行数据处理时,有时我们需要复制多个不连续的区域,但是Excel并不直接支持该操作。那么我们应该如何实现呢?下面就为大家介绍一种简单的方法。打开Excel文件首先,打开你要进行操作的Excel文件。例如,我需要将上面的不连续

  3. 3 如何设置浏览器鼠标手势和快捷键

    在日常的上网过程中,浏览器是我们最常用的工具之一,它为我们提供了许多便利。但是,如果你不知道如何设置浏览器的鼠标手势和快捷键,那么你可能会错过一些非常实用的功能。1. 更新浏览器首先,当你打开你的浏览器时,检查是否有更新提示。如果有,安装更

  4. 4 颜色原理详解

    在进行Photoshop学习之前,对于色彩的了解是非常重要的。在本文中,我们将详细讨论颜色原理,帮助你更好地理解和应用颜色。光谱和三基色原理我们在中学物理课上可能做过棱镜的实验,通过棱镜将白光分解为逐渐过渡的多种颜色,即可见光谱。人眼对红、

  5. 5 利用Photoshop制作出梦幻般的气泡效果

    在Photoshop中想要为图像添加独特的气泡效果并不难。以下是具体的操作步骤:步骤1: 新建画布首先新建一个画布,设置合适的尺寸。步骤2: 添加镜头光晕效果执行"滤镜" > "渲染" > "镜头光晕",调整光晕的位置和大小,使之符合效果需

  6. 6 鲁大师检测电脑屏幕坏点的操作流程

    现代电脑已成为我们日常生活和工作中不可或缺的一部分。然而,有时我们可能会遇到屏幕出现坏点的问题,这会影响我们的使用体验。幸运的是,鲁大师提供了一个简单而有效的方法来检测电脑屏幕上的坏点。打开鲁大师并选择屏幕检测首先,您需要下载并安装最新版本

  7. 7 如何改变Steam游戏中的截图地址

    Steam是一个广受欢迎的游戏平台,许多玩家喜欢在游戏过程中截取精彩的瞬间。然而,有时我们可能不知道这些截图保存在哪里,或者希望更改截图的保存路径。本文将向您介绍如何改变Steam游戏中的截图地址。步骤一:打开Steam设置首先,您需要打开

  8. 8 如何设置Win10显示图标和通知

    Windows 10作为目前最新的操作系统,提供了丰富的个性化设置选项,其中包括了任务栏的显示图标和通知的设置。本文将介绍如何通过简单的步骤来设置Win10的任务栏图标和通知。步骤一:右击任务栏,选择任务栏设置首先,在桌面任意位置右击鼠标,

  9. 9 如何关闭QQ聊天窗口中的QQ秀

    在使用QQ聊天窗口时,我们经常会遇到一个问题:每次打开聊天窗口都会弹出QQ秀,这不仅影响了我们的使用体验,还会拖慢加载速度。那么,怎样才能永久关闭聊天窗口中的QQ秀呢?下面将为大家介绍具体的操作步骤。第一步:登录QQ账号首先,打开QQ客户端

  10. 10 如何在NBA2K20中完成持球过人?

    NBA2K20是一款备受喜爱的篮球游戏,但是很多玩家可能不知道如何在游戏中持球过人。在本文中,我们将详细介绍如何在NBA2K20中完成持球过人的操作。第一步:下载并安装NBA2K20如果您还没有下载和安装NBA2K20,首先需要前往百度搜索

Copyright 2025 优质自媒体,让大家了解更多图文资讯!百度地图 360地图